Webhow the republican calendar worked Each year, there were twelve months of 30 days. A month was divided into three décades of ten days, with the décade ’s last day being a rest day. It was a criminal offence to close a shop on what before had been a Sunday. WebStephen P. WebIn 1793, the French revolutionaries decided to introduce a calendar which still had 12 months, but each month would be made up of a fixed 30 days. The 30 days would be divided into 3 weeks of 10 days each, instead of 4 …
